Beschreibung:

[Medicine] SYDENHAM, Thomas Opera medica [...] Editio novissima [...]. Geneva, De Tournes brothers, 3 parts in 2 vol., 4to: front.-[10]-[4]-[8]-[8]-pp. (toned, occ. foxing and soiling, front. and title of vol. I with sm. losses). Contemp. mottled calf, gilt-orn. spines with raised bands and a label on vol. II, red edges (covers with large scratches, joints loosening, turn-ins with def., repaired in some places). Revised ed. (1st ed.: Geneva, of the collected medical works of the English physician Sydenham (1624-1689), a founder of epidemiology, nicknamed the "English Hippocrates" of his time. Title of vol. I printed in red and black. With 2 additional treatises by Musgrave (1655-1721), also in revised editions, each with its own title-page, as in the other Geneva editions by De Tournes. Ref. Blake - Wellcome V:- Bibl. Walleriana 9403-(other ed.). - Not in Garrison & Morton. Joined: Dionis, P. - Cours d'opérations de chirurgie, démontrées au Jardin Royal. Huitième édition [...]. Paris, widow d'Houry, 8vo: portrait-front.-xvi-pp.; pl. (sm. wormholes and -tracks throughout, last ff. with water stains, occ. spotting). Contemp. marbled calf, gilt-orn. spine, spine with def., joints repaired). Ill. with an engr. author's portrait, 1 front. (amphitheater lesson), plates (2 fold.) and woodcuts in-text. Ref. Wellcome II:(pp.). - Blake - Cp. Garrison & Morton (ed.) and Bibl. Walleriana (other ed.). Prov. P. Mendé (ex-libris, 20th c.). (3 vol.) Starting bid:
